Tommy Stinson's new CD proceeds to help Haiti kids (AP)

FILE - In this July 31, 2010 file photo, Guns N' Roses musician Tommy Stinson attends the graduation ceremony for former street youth at the Timkatec school in Port-au-Prince, Haiti. Stinson, 43, is devoting his time and money to a new passion: helping children left homeless by the Haitian earthquake. 'One Man Mutiny,' his second solo effort, comes out Aug. 30 on his own label. He plans to donate half of the proceeds to Timkatec, a nonprofit that houses and educates homeless children in the Port-au-Prince area. (AP Photo/Ramon Espinosa, File)AP - A year after Tommy Stinson's online auction raised nearly $50,000 for children ravaged by last year's earthquake in Haiti, the Replacements bassist is getting ready to help out again.
